I was interested in purchasing a copy of Mathematica for Solaris, but
have seen various things on the net suggesting the Solaris (and to a
lesser extent linux) versions are more buggy than the Windows version.

Looking on the Wolfram web site where one can request a trial

http://www.wolfram.com/products/mathematica/experience/request.cgi

I find one can't request a trail on Solaris from the web site.

So I  contacted Wolfram Research directly by email and asked about a
14-day save-disabled trail. I received a reply in a couple of days,
telling me no trial version of Mathematica exists for Solaris.

Given the Solaris version is more expensive than the windows one,
there are various reports of bugs on Solaris, and one can't even get a
trail version, it does beg the question whether Wolfram Research are
serious about the future of Mathematica on Solaris.
